twinaphex
8837139271
(360) Build fixes
2013-09-15 18:49:18 +02:00
meancoot
cb55a1d45a
(Apple) Reorganize source tree
2013-09-05 01:24:27 -04:00
Themaister
32cae444a0
Fixup new private extensions.
...
Moved private stuff to libretro_private.h.
Dropped use of retro_variable (redundant and wrong type).
Didn't understand difference between EXEC_LOAD and EXEC_RELOAD at all.
Only one was used anyways ...
2013-08-25 11:10:32 +02:00
twinaphex
8aef9f4c64
Hide away g_settings.libretro mutation and do calls to environment
...
callback action instead - frontends should do it this way as well
2013-08-24 23:08:40 +02:00
meancoot
9e2e135d19
(Apple) Get rid of some hacks in the frontend code.
2013-08-14 00:48:58 -04:00
Themaister
fe24d961e3
Add args to ps3 environment.
2013-08-11 15:21:23 +02:00
twinaphex
b805efa59a
(frontend) Additional param to argc/argv for iOS/OSX ports
2013-08-10 21:31:11 +02:00
twinaphex
d640c16eb3
(Frontend) Move more platform-specific code into environment_get function
...
implementations
2013-08-10 20:59:10 +02:00
twinaphex
c7d3c9e955
(Apple) Fix build
2013-07-28 23:01:16 +02:00
twinaphex
56974007ad
(frontend) Cleanups to frontend.c
2013-07-28 20:57:49 +02:00
twinaphex
f51e748ba8
(PS3) Fix core loading
2013-07-27 22:33:57 +02:00
twinaphex
db9462bc49
(GX) Build fixes
2013-07-27 21:38:38 +02:00
twinaphex
2323cee6a7
Get rid of MODE_EXIT
2013-07-27 20:34:06 +02:00
twinaphex
29b13676c5
(Apple) Implement environment_get in Apple frontend context driver
2013-07-27 17:45:56 +02:00
twinaphex
e19d2320b2
(frontend_context) Implement process_events
2013-07-27 17:42:09 +02:00
twinaphex
ac8f57e679
Add platform_apple.c frontend driver
2013-07-27 17:40:21 +02:00
twinaphex
a9dd629fe6
Uniquely name each frontend context driver
2013-07-27 17:32:15 +02:00
twinaphex
003635499f
Add QNX frontend context file
2013-07-27 17:16:46 +02:00
twinaphex
40d5fcc472
Add shutdown to frontend_context.c - bake frontend_context in for all versions
2013-07-27 16:36:55 +02:00
twinaphex
4eb283b7e3
Cleanups to frontend_ctx
2013-07-27 12:59:23 +02:00
twinaphex
1e70a46dd8
Merge platform_ files with platform_exec.c files
2013-07-27 03:59:01 +02:00
twinaphex
2650bec798
Setup platform_xdk as context as well
2013-07-27 00:32:56 +02:00
twinaphex
69381c2735
Add frontend_context.c - use for all console platform ports
...
(and other possible ports in future)
2013-07-26 20:58:47 +02:00
twinaphex
fe433b2322
Add new header file_ext.h - refactor out frontend_console.h
2013-07-15 14:54:40 +02:00
ToadKing
35da2fd555
(GX) re-enable IOS reloading, fixes lingering USB issues
2013-05-28 22:20:36 -04:00
twinaphex
360184d49e
(PS3) Fixes 'Return To Multiman' option
2013-05-28 22:15:21 +02:00
twinaphex
823b9a6a5d
(Android) Add big changelog changes to Android built-in resources
...
(PS3) *blind coding* hopefully fix Return To Multiman option
2013-05-26 22:41:44 +02:00
ToadKing
c673c28274
(GX) fix crash on empty argv
2013-05-20 22:19:10 -04:00
ToadKing
812d78839d
(GX) add hack for bad Salamander behavior
2013-05-19 20:40:48 -04:00
ToadKing
f3b4fbbb2d
(GX) remove IOS reloading, was messing up Salamander and threaded device insertion fixed the issue we were having anyway
2013-05-19 20:40:13 -04:00
ToadKing
57058ee25f
(GX) fix potential memory corruption in rarch_console_exec
2013-05-19 20:39:08 -04:00
twinaphex
6e2fc94c5e
(360) Fix Salamander build
2013-05-10 23:38:54 +02:00
twinaphex
523a27ce61
(360) Load Game History list now works on 360 as well
2013-05-10 22:44:58 +02:00
ToadKing
5290a25ccd
(GX) support ROM passing through salamander
...
Needed on Wii since we might need to load salamander when switching cores due to memory issues
2013-05-08 19:11:52 -04:00
ToadKing
0c08726a8e
(GX) workaround weird bug in file detection
2013-05-05 23:06:57 -04:00
twinaphex
0a8ee17d55
(PS3/GX/PSP) Use new default 'savefile' directory called 'savefiles'
...
instead of 'sram'
2013-05-06 00:31:24 +02:00
twinaphex
af867b008d
(XDK) Make initial 'default paths' creation of dirs work
...
on XDK
2013-05-06 00:30:45 +02:00
twinaphex
fd27c1b7ca
(RARCH_CONSOLE) Check if needed directories exist and if not,
...
create them
2013-05-06 00:06:08 +02:00
twinaphex
6a1eb0c0b1
(PS3/RMenu) Move oskutil_handle to menu_common.h
2013-05-05 16:12:06 +02:00
twinaphex
092b2625dd
(RMenu/RGUI) Drop MODE_MENU_INGAME
2013-05-05 15:20:45 +02:00
ToadKing
0c0e4d1ddd
(GX) set argv[0] when switching cores
2013-04-29 22:05:21 -04:00
ToadKing
203435487e
(GX SALAMANDER) fix hang in salamander
2013-04-29 21:55:23 -04:00
ToadKing
e01244acfa
(GX) clear framebuffer before exit
2013-04-29 16:08:56 -04:00
twinaphex
69aa79b1e9
(RARCH_CONSOLE) When we encounter a CORE executable - rename,
...
save and exit app.
2013-04-29 19:37:02 +02:00
twinaphex
8f2ed9a405
(XDK1) Load Game (History) works now on Xbox 1
2013-04-29 18:05:48 +02:00
twinaphex
ded204ce19
(PS3) Load Game History works on PS3 - Multiman will from now on
...
have to supply its own SELF path to argv[2] in order to work
2013-04-29 15:19:52 +02:00
ToadKing
455167ec19
(GX) error checking fix
2013-04-29 08:27:16 -04:00
twinaphex
51aa5b170f
(RMenu) Fixes/cleanups
2013-04-29 03:59:48 +02:00
twinaphex
4a772c3fa8
(Wii) Working Load Game History
2013-04-29 03:05:46 +02:00
ToadKing
74faafff37
buildfix
2013-04-28 20:06:32 -04:00